The Scenic Drive to Little River
Your day begins with a drive through the lush Canterbury countryside toward Little River. This small village is often overlooked but is packed with charm—art galleries, craft shops, and inviting natural scenery. It’s an ideal spot to stretch your legs and snap some photos of New Zealand’s rolling hills and colorful art. We appreciate how this stop offers a gentle start to the day, giving travelers a sense of local life beyond tourist hotspots.
Barry’s Bay Cheese Factory: Tasting Traditional Local Flavors
Next, your group visits Barry Bay Cheese, where you can sample handcrafted cheeses made using traditional methods. Watching the cheesemaking process through viewing windows adds an educational element, making this more than just a quick snack stop. Many visitors comment on the quality and variety of the cheeses, making it a highlight for food lovers. Tasting freshly made cheese while learning about local artisanal methods provides an authentic taste of New Zealand’s dairy excellence.
Exploring the Akaroa Lighthouse and War Memorial
Moving on, the tour stops at the historically restored Akaroa Lighthouse, which once served as a vital navigation aid. From its vantage point, you’ll enjoy sweeping views of Akaroa Harbour and the surrounding hills—a perfect photo opportunity and a chance to appreciate the area’s maritime history. Just nearby, the Banks Peninsula War Memorial offers a moment of quiet reflection and insight into the local community’s sacrifices. These stops are brief but meaningful, adding depth to your understanding of the region’s heritage.
The Heart of the Day: Akaroa Village
Spending around two hours in Akaroa lets you soak up the small-town atmosphere of this French-inspired harbor town. Expect charming streets lined with cafes, boutique shops, and waterfront views. Frequently Asked Questions

Is hotel pickup available for this tour?
Yes, the tour includes pickup and drop-off from Christchurch hotels, making logistics easy and hassle-free.
How long is the tour?
Expect the tour to last between 8 and 10 hours, depending on the day’s pace and optional activities you choose to include.
Can I book the dolphin cruise separately?
Yes, the dolphin cruise is an optional extra that you can book separately, costing NZ$119 per person. It’s not included in the base price.
What is included in the tour price?
The tour includes private air-conditioned transportation, WiFi onboard, a professional guide, bottled water, and several complimentary stops.
Are meals provided?
No, meals are not included, so plan to bring snacks or purchase food at stops like Akaroa.
Is this tour suitable for children or families?
Most travelers can participate, and the gentle pace makes it family-friendly, though young children should be supervised during stops like the lighthouse.
What should I wear or bring?
Comfortable clothing, layers for changing weather, a camera, and a hat or sunscreen are recommended. If you plan to join the dolphin cruise, consider bringing a waterproof jacket.
What is the cancellation policy?
You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, providing flexibility if your plans change unexpectedly.
